What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To make sense of the significance of freestyle trap beats, it's vital to initially break down what a freestyle beat actually is. In easy terms, a freestyle beat is an important track that is designed for artists to rap or sing over without the need for pre-written verses or tunes. It's suggested to inspire off-the-cuff efficiencies, motivating rap artists to provide spontaneous and usually extra raw, impulsive verses.

A freestyle type beat differs a little from a normal instrumental in that it's structured in such a way that provides musicians area to take a breath. These beats typically have less melodious elements, leaving room for intricate flows and powerful wordplay. They're also commonly a lot more repetitive than traditional track instrumentals, making sure that the rap artist or singer can quickly discover their groove and ride the beat without getting shed in complicated setups.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the realm of freestyle beats, there is a details subset called freestyle trap beat. Trap music, stemming from the southerly USA, is defined by bulky use 808 bass drums, fast h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ody melodies. It's a noise that has grown in popularity for many years, turning into one of the most prominent styles in modern-day r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ature details and fuse them with the liberty and adaptability of freestyle beats, leading to a dynamic combination. These beats are perfect for artists looking to bring power and aggression to their knowledgeables while still preserving the liberty to check out different circulations and styles.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Idol

Amongst the many variants of freestyle catch beats, the DaBaby type beat has actually become one of one of the most desired. DaBaby type beats are inspired by the trademark noise of the North Carolina rapper DaBaby, known for his rapid-fire delivery, catchy hooks, and hard-hitting production. These beats usually include quick tempos,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et hostile melodies, making them best for high-energy freestyle performances.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So perfect for Freestyles

1. Fast Paces: The quick speed of a DaBaby type beat urges rappers to deliver rapid-fire flows, compeling them to believe on their feet and push their lyrical limits.
2. Easy Yet Catchy Tunes: Unlike some trap beats that can be overly intricate, DaBaby type beats are typically developed around easy, repetitive tunes that leave space for the rapper's vocals to beam.
3. Potent Drums: The aggressive percussion in these beats adds an element of necessity, driving the musician to match the beat's intensity with their verses.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ers use free of charge use, normally for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be utilized for trials, freestyles, and social media content, artists typically need to invest a certificate if they want to launch the tune commercially (i.e., on streaming platforms or to buy).

This version has actually been a game-changer, enabling young artists to try out their sound, practice their freestyling, and build an internet existence without having to worry about manufacturing prices.
